仮想モバイルインフラ市場の2023年の市場規模は7億1,983万米ドル、2024年には8億8,631万米ドルに達すると予測され、CAGR 23.61%で成長し、2030年には31億7,461万米ドルに達すると予測されています。

仮想モバイルインフラ(VMI)は、モバイルアプリケーションを集中管理されたサーバーにカプセル化し、仮想環境を介してさまざまなエンドポイントデバイスに配信する革新的な技術です。このアプローチは、従来のデバイス固有のアプリケーション・インストールから、より柔軟で安全なソフトウェア展開への移行を意味します。VMIの必要性は、特にエンタープライズIT、ヘルスケア、金融など、高レベルのデータセキュリティとリモートアクセス機能を必要とする分野において、セキュアでスケーラブル、かつデバイスに依存しないモバイルコンピューティングソリューションに対する需要が高まっていることからも明らかです。VMIは、デバイスの盗難や紛失に伴うリスクを軽減しながら、企業データを管理するための強固なフレームワークを提供します。より効率的なモバイルワークフォース管理を求める大企業から、アプリやデータへのアクセスを効率化したいサービスプロバイダーや教育分野まで、エンドユースの範囲は多岐にわたる。

VMI市場に影響を与える主な成長要因には、急増するモバイルワークフォースの動向、サイバーセキュリティの脅威の高まり、リモートワークモデルの台頭などがあります。潜在的なビジネスチャンスは、クラウドベースのインフラの拡大と、VMIの有効性に必要なシームレスで高速なデータトランスミッションを加速する5G技術の出現にあります。しかし市場は、初期設定コストの高さ、既存のITシステムとの統合の複雑さ、遅延やアプリケーション・パフォーマンスへの懸念といった課題に直面しています。これらの限界に対処するには、VMIのユーザー体験と相互運用性を高めるための集中的な技術革新が必要です。

基盤となる仮想化技術の最適化と費用対効果の改善に関する調査と技術革新は、ビジネス成長の有望分野です。市場は競争的でありながらダイナミックであり、ニーズの進化に伴い、ベンダーは継続的なイノベーションを求められています。現在のビジネスチャンスを生かすための提言としては、クラウド・サービス・プロバイダーとのパートナーシップへの投資や、人工知能の進化による業務のさらなる効率化などが挙げられます。また、コンプライアンス基準を遵守するために規制機関と協力することも、ビジネスを有利に進めることができます。全体として、仮想モバイルインフラ市場は、その複雑性を乗り越え、その可能性を活用しようとする組織にとって、大きな成長が約束されています。

The Virtual Mobile Infrastructure Market was valued at USD 719.83 million in 2023, expected to reach USD 886.31 million in 2024, and is projected to grow at a CAGR of 23.61%, to USD 3,174.61 million by 2030.

Virtual Mobile Infrastructure (VMI) is an innovative technology that encapsulates mobile applications on centralized servers, delivering them via virtual environments to a variety of endpoint devices. This approach signifies a shift from traditional device-specific App installations to a more flexible and secure software deployment. The necessity of VMI is underscored by the increasing demand for secure, scalable, and device-independent mobile computing solutions, especially in sectors like enterprise IT, healthcare, and finance that require high levels of data security and remote access capabilities. In its application, VMI provides a robust framework for managing corporate data while mitigating risks associated with device theft or loss. The end-use scope is wide-ranging, from large enterprises seeking more efficient mobile workforce management to service providers and education sectors looking to streamline access to apps and data.

Key growth factors influencing the VMI market include burgeoning mobile workforce trends, escalating cybersecurity threats, and the rise of remote working models. Potential opportunities lie in the expansion of cloud-based infrastructure and the advent of 5G technology, which accelerate seamless, high-speed data transmission necessary for VMI efficacy. However, the market faces challenges such as high initial setup costs, complexities in integration with existing IT systems, and concerns over latency and application performance. Addressing these limitations requires focused innovation in enhancing VMI's user experience and interoperability.

Research and innovation in optimizing the underlying virtualization technology and improving cost-effectiveness are promising areas for business growth. The market is competitive yet dynamic, with evolving needs urging vendors to innovate continuously. Recommendations to capitalize on current opportunities include investing in partnerships with cloud service providers and advancing artificial intelligence to streamline operations further. Engaging with regulatory bodies to adhere to compliance standards can also position businesses favorably. Overall, the Virtual Mobile Infrastructure market promises substantial growth for organizations willing to navigate its complexities and leverage its potential.
